Air compressors are more dangerous than I thought

A key point about that video: That compressor tank had previously rusted through and was repaired. DO NOT DO THAT and you're unlikely to experience any issues with a compressor tank unless it's ancient. Most of the time, they develop pinholes that will do nothing but leak air when the rust gets bad enough. When or if it gets to that point, send it to the scrap yard and buy another.
